23d98e126c282a19088478ca296e147cf4f481de: Bug 959118 - Dump layer tree with layer scope on the viewer. r=dglastonbury
Boris Chiou <boris.chiou@gmail.com> - Sun, 27 Jul 2014 22:32:00 +0200 - rev 196381
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 959118 - Dump layer tree with layer scope on the viewer. r=dglastonbury We also want to dump layer tree on the viewer, so we can check the layer tree and layerscope together in the viewer. This can help us resolve more gfx bugs. In this patch, I only add a part of the layer data to the protocol buffer packet, and you can check the .proto file for more information if you want to add more layer data. By the way, as Jeff's suggestion, use auto & MakeUnique<>() to make the UniquePtr initialization more concise.
1bab131ebe628f61068edbc0eb22a8fd6615425c: Backed out changeset 4058c55db564 (bug 1015932) for bustage on a CLOSED TREE
Carsten "Tomcat" Book <cbook@mozilla.com> - Mon, 28 Jul 2014 11:52:29 +0200 - rev 196380
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Backed out changeset 4058c55db564 (bug 1015932) for bustage on a CLOSED TREE
f408f7da5b2ac8cd9c182bdea58238ad62228c54: Backed out changeset e9b23c66ef10 (bug 1015932)
Carsten "Tomcat" Book <cbook@mozilla.com> - Mon, 28 Jul 2014 11:52:05 +0200 - rev 196379
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Backed out changeset e9b23c66ef10 (bug 1015932)
8b9f3cc69cbf86830c1afed39e91a6b799d0f730: Backed out changeset 10f8441b42a1 (bug 1015932)
Carsten "Tomcat" Book <cbook@mozilla.com> - Mon, 28 Jul 2014 11:52:04 +0200 - rev 196378
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Backed out changeset 10f8441b42a1 (bug 1015932)
027452afde9df86134afa028a556f4d5920f51a0: Backed out changeset 6289b18d2127 (bug 1015932)
Carsten "Tomcat" Book <cbook@mozilla.com> - Mon, 28 Jul 2014 11:51:58 +0200 - rev 196377
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Backed out changeset 6289b18d2127 (bug 1015932)
c03c2e8e2a21e58180c38f9b34c3a7624b446414: Bug 1043888 - Make GetObjetZone() work on nursery objects and rename GetGCThingZone() to GetTenuredGCThingZone() r=terrence
Jon Coppeard <jcoppeard@mozilla.com> - Mon, 28 Jul 2014 10:39:36 +0100 - rev 196376
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1043888 - Make GetObjetZone() work on nursery objects and rename GetGCThingZone() to GetTenuredGCThingZone() r=terrence
6289b18d21278feece663cd0795119aeeb081576: Bug 1015932 - Move OpenSLES Realize into the engine broker. r=padenot
Gian-Carlo Pascutto <gpascutto@mozilla.com> - Mon, 28 Jul 2014 11:29:31 +0200 - rev 196375
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1015932 - Move OpenSLES Realize into the engine broker. r=padenot
10f8441b42a199d9ceb4de6584800e0a7d95f522: Bug 1015932 - Make WebRTC and libcubeb use the OpenSLES engine broker. r=padenot
Gian-Carlo Pascutto <gpascutto@mozilla.com> - Mon, 28 Jul 2014 11:29:31 +0200 - rev 196374
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1015932 - Make WebRTC and libcubeb use the OpenSLES engine broker. r=padenot
e9b23c66ef1009a9ed38fd399a8ccfb535081637: Bug 1015932 - Add systemservices subdir to content/media. r=jesup
Gian-Carlo Pascutto <gpascutto@mozilla.com> - Mon, 28 Jul 2014 11:29:31 +0200 - rev 196373
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1015932 - Add systemservices subdir to content/media. r=jesup
4058c55db5644f4519db0c400789794e2f2f142b: Bug 1015932 - Shareable OpenSLES engine between cubeb and WebRTC. r=jesup
Gian-Carlo Pascutto <gpascutto@mozilla.com> - Mon, 28 Jul 2014 11:29:31 +0200 - rev 196372
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1015932 - Shareable OpenSLES engine between cubeb and WebRTC. r=jesup
fedb725da886f0759f1ab21801bec368bf9f3d1f: Bug 1044198: convert margins from the frame's writing mode to the line's writing mode in nsBidiPresUtils::RepositionInlineFrames, r=jfkthame.
Simon Montagu <smontagu@smontagu.org> - Mon, 28 Jul 2014 01:20:58 -0700 - rev 196371
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1044198: convert margins from the frame's writing mode to the line's writing mode in nsBidiPresUtils::RepositionInlineFrames, r=jfkthame.
b0fe08bd921f63b717f1d2e38313cd207a06bcd3: Test for bug 1044198
dholbert@mozilla.com - Mon, 28 Jul 2014 01:20:56 -0700 - rev 196370
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Test for bug 1044198
b1bdbcfa69c1eb0790d3c0da5f0080ae6b512e8a: Bug 1037936 - Part 3: Replace nsCxPusher in nsWindowWatcher::OpenWindowInternal. r=bholley
Bob Owen <bobowencode@gmail.com> - Mon, 28 Jul 2014 08:12:54 +0100 - rev 196369
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1037936 - Part 3: Replace nsCxPusher in nsWindowWatcher::OpenWindowInternal. r=bholley
21264d92a9d8a1516db79b517324ca7d0f9799c5: Bug 1037936 - Part 2: Replace second nsCxPusher in nsWindowWatcher::OpenWindowInternal. r=bholley
Bob Owen <bobowencode@gmail.com> - Mon, 28 Jul 2014 07:57:31 +0100 - rev 196368
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1037936 - Part 2: Replace second nsCxPusher in nsWindowWatcher::OpenWindowInternal. r=bholley
258e6048d585c4a86e98cbf6045afa34c4cf7f18: Bug 1037936 - Part 1: Replace nsCxPusher in nsXBLBinding::ChangeDocument. r=bholley
Bob Owen <bobowencode@gmail.com> - Tue, 15 Jul 2014 16:39:17 +0100 - rev 196367
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1037936 - Part 1: Replace nsCxPusher in nsXBLBinding::ChangeDocument. r=bholley
92b7bbf5c1afa386d768e5c5a8cc7baa4d23100b: Bug 1035570 (part 3) - DMD: Add DMDAnalyzeHeap(), a heap snapshot function. r=erahm,mccr8.
Nicholas Nethercote <nnethercote@mozilla.com> - Thu, 29 May 2014 23:46:09 -0700 - rev 196366
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1035570 (part 3) - DMD: Add DMDAnalyzeHeap(), a heap snapshot function. r=erahm,mccr8. The patch also adds DMDAnalyzeReports() as a synonym for DMDReportAndDump(), and deprecates the latter.
c58334ac43628dc5225d989576c538a4ee35a70f: Bug 1035570 (part 2) - DMD: make output easier for machines to parse. r=erahm.
Nicholas Nethercote <nnethercote@mozilla.com> - Thu, 05 Jun 2014 19:06:50 -0700 - rev 196365
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1035570 (part 2) - DMD: make output easier for machines to parse. r=erahm. There are likely to be post-processing scripts for DMD added in the future. In anticipation, this patch tweaks DMD's output to be a little more conducive to machine parsing. The basic idea is this: - Lines beginning with '#' are comments and can be ignored, as can blank lines. - All top level blocks consist of a string ending with '{', and then one or more indented lines, and then a closing '}' on its own line. Any multi-line things within a block are themselves enclosed in braces. The diff for memory/replace/dmd/test-expected.dmd shows what this looks like in practice. It's a long way from a formal grammar or anything like that, but that would be overkill. In this form it's quite easy to parse with simple scripts that just do line-based regexp matching, rather than proper parsing. And it's still very readable to humans, so I think it's a reasonable balance overall.
664fbd3821c72cf4ea92fa6f0014c823d5cbeddf: Bug 1035570 (part 1) - DMD: Rename TraceRecord as Record. r=erahm.
Nicholas Nethercote <nnethercote@mozilla.com> - Thu, 05 Jun 2014 18:57:02 -0700 - rev 196364
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1035570 (part 1) - DMD: Rename TraceRecord as Record. r=erahm. DMD used to have "stack trace records" and "stack frame records". Bug 1013011 removed the latter, and now "stack trace record" and |TraceRecord| are a bit unwieldy. This patch changes them to "heap block record" and |Record|.
56efa7ae8500bad30f4155d793bc1285614dcee2: Bug 1045419 - Disable test_crash_manager.js for failures on a CLOSED TREE r=me
Wes Kocher <wkocher@mozilla.com> - Mon, 28 Jul 2014 20:14:19 -0700 - rev 196363
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1045419 - Disable test_crash_manager.js for failures on a CLOSED TREE r=me
c4a45feb56705eefe2ae60a0069a4e4844f5ac64: Bug 1045255 - Add back global logging setup removed in bug 886570 needed for leak logging on a CLOSED TREE.;r=gps
Chris Manchester <cmanchester@mozilla.com> - Mon, 28 Jul 2014 19:51:55 -0400 - rev 196362
Push 1 by root at Mon, 20 Oct 2014 17:29:22 +0000
Bug 1045255 - Add back global logging setup removed in bug 886570 needed for leak logging on a CLOSED TREE.;r=gps
(0) -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 +300000 tip